Invertebrate Zoology with Laboratory

PreRequisites: Students will receive partial credit for 103LF after taking 103.
Offered through Integrative Biology
About this Course
Catalog Course Description

Introductory survey of the biology of invertebrates, stressing comparative functional morphology, phylogeny, natural history, and aspects of physiology and development. Laboratory study of invertebrate diversity and functional morphology, and field study of the natural history of local marine invertebrates.
